Definition and Scope:
Automatic commercial sensor faucets are advanced plumbing fixtures designed for commercial settings such as public restrooms, hospitals, restaurants, and hotels. These faucets are equipped with sensors that detect the presence of hands or objects underneath the spout, triggering water flow. The key feature of automatic sensor faucets is their touchless operation, promoting hygiene by reducing the spread of germs and bacteria. They are typically made of durable materials such as brass or stainless steel to withstand heavy usage in high-traffic areas. These faucets are known for their convenience, water-saving capabilities, and modern aesthetic appeal, making them a popular choice in commercial spaces.
The market for automatic commercial sensor faucets is experiencing steady growth driven by several factors. Increasing awareness about hygiene and sanitation in public spaces is leading to a higher demand for touchless fixtures like sensor faucets. Government regulations promoting water conservation are also driving the adoption of sensor faucets, as they are designed to reduce water wastage by automatically shutting off after use. Moreover, advancements in sensor technology and the availability of energy-efficient models are further fueling market growth. The convenience and ease of maintenance offered by automatic sensor faucets are also contributing to their rising popularity among commercial property owners and facility managers. At the same time, the growing trend of smart buildings and IoT integration in commercial spaces is expected to create new opportunities for market expansion in the coming years.
The global Automatic Commercial Sensor Faucets market size was estimated at USD 1137.44 million in 2024, exhibiting a CAGR of 8.70% during the forecast period.
